Blues Guitar Book by Peter Vogl is the
way to learn Blues rhythm and soloing from one of the best
teachers and players in the Southeast.
This companion book to
Introduction to Blues Guitar Video shows exact hand
positions to learn how to properly play rhythm to the 12 Bar
Blues and learn scales (Em pentatonic and Blues Scales).
It covers all the
material in the video (learning how to solo up and down the
neck of the guitar), plus it has additional information
(playing in other keys up and down the neck, blues
turnarounds, an expanded hot licks section, and an appendix
covering a variety of information).
The companion audio CD
contains all of the music in the book played at two speeds
(slow for practice and up tempo for performing) and all solos
are played along with a full band (drums, bass, keyboard, and
rhythm guitar).
This book contains all
you need to become a blues player
